FTRI
First Trust Indxx Global Natural Resources Income ETF
FTRI Description
The investment seeks invest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ield (before the fund's fees and expenses) of an equity index called the Indxx Global Natural Resources Income Index. The fund will normally invest at least 90% of its net assets (including investment borrowings) in common stocks and/or depositary receipts that comprise the index. The index is a 50-stock free float adjusted market capitalization weighted index designed to measure the market performance of the 50 highest dividend yielding companies involved in the upstream segment of the natural resources sector. The fund is non-diversified.

URNM
NorthShore Global Uranium Mining ETF
URNM Description
The investment seeks to provide investment results that, before fees and expenses, correspond generally to the total return performance of the North Shore Global Uranium Mining Index. The fund will normally invest at least 80% of its total assets in securities of the index. The index is designed to track the performance of companies that are involved in the mining, exploration, development, and production of uranium, and companies that hold physical uranium, uranium royalties, or other non-mining assets (Uranium Companies).
